Symptom: Horizontal Black Bar (Completely dark)
Note: The use of a magnifying glass can help localize the defective printed circuit board. Use the magnifying glass to take a close look at the pixels in the area of the black bar.
1 If the pixels are totally dark, the defect is |
| |
most likely located in one of the following |
| |
boards: | Figure 41 | |
a) SC Board | ||
|
b)SU Board (upper half of the screen only)
c)SD Board (lower half of the screen only)
2.If the pixels are dimly lit, the defect is most likely located in one of the following boards:
a)SS Board
b)SS2 Board (upper half of the screen only)
c)SS3 Board (lower half of the screen only)
